Well that handle was a failure, it split on me so I went back to the drawing board.
No big deal though because that handle was quick and dirty.

A broken axe handle, some brass pins, epoxy, a twine wrap to cover up the gaps ( handle is wider than the machete tang) and the blaze orange duct tape just to cover everything up.

This light thin 22" blade with a long handle should be one helluva brush and weed slasher .

The axe handle recalls the handle on a real malaysain parang. I know the shape is not the same, but it has that look.

Same handle as the 22"er I got but much more appropriate on that little one there.

Btw these black plastic handles may look about the same as a cheap Chinese Walmart machete, but I can tell you those like to crack and break but Incolma is definitely using a tougher plastic.
